Meet Dr. Dana Laridaen

As the founder and leader of our center, Dr. Laridaen has built her own version of a dream team for wellness. What started as a solo practice after a decade of experience, O2 has grown into a full-spectrum center for alternative healthcare.

Dr. Laridaen has created this space to foster not only a wildly loyal patient base, but also a community where patients feel understood and empowered opening up about their unique route to healing. She mindfully chooses each provider to counter and complement one another so there is always someone to connect with, no matter what concern a patient brings into the office.

Dr. Laridaen received her Doctor of Chiropractic Degree from Palmer West in 2007. She has been treating patients in Los Angeles since 2008 and started O2 Chiropractic and Wellness in 2012. She specializes in Diversified technique along with Activator and extremity adjustments. She treats an array of patients including but not limited to pre and postnatal mothers, high end athletes, children, pre-teens and teens involved in sports, and your everyday person like most of us who sit at computers all week and then live on the weekends.

O2 Chiropractic & Wellness was founded on February 2, 2012, by Dr. Dana Laridaen with a simple yet powerful vision: to create a welcoming space where patients could receive expert, integrative care under one roof.

What began as a small practice with just Dr. Laridaen and one massage therapist has blossomed into a thriving wellness center with a team of 17, including experts in chiropractic care, acupuncture, massage therapy, Pilates, personal training, functional medicine, and more.

SoftWave FAQs

  • What results should I expect from SoftWave Therapy?

    If you are a candidate for treatment, SoftWave therapy can provide both immediate and long-lasting results. After one SoftWave session, patients typically experience a 20-50% reduction in pain and improvement in mobility, lasting from a few hours to several days. Some patients require multiple sessions before experiencing improvement.

  • What is the SoftWave treatment process like?

    SoftWave is a fast and convenient non-invasive procedure that usually lasts 10-15 minutes, with no downtime required for recovery. First, ultrasound gel is applied, then the SoftWave device is gently placed to deliver shock waves to the injured area. Most patients feel a gentle tapping or pulsing sensation, while some patients may experience mild pain or discomfort. The use of anesthesia or numbing agents is not necessary. Effective communication with the provider during treatment can help identify treatment hotspots and track progress.

    Is SoftWave therapy safe with prescription medication?

    SoftWave therapy can be safely combined with prescription medication in most cases.

    Is SoftWave therapy safe after surgery?

    SoftWave therapy is generally safe after surgery, depending on the type of surgery performed. In fact, it is commonly used to accelerate healing and post-surgical rehabilitation. Some doctors even use SoftWave in the operating room immediately after surgery, to activate the body’s healing process.

    Is SoftWave safe with metal in your body?

    SoftWave therapy is safe for patients with metal in their body, such as pins, plates, or joint replacements.

    Is SoftWave safe with a blood pressure condition?

    Yes, Softwave is generally safe for patients with blood pressure conditions, like high or low blood pressure.

    Who is NOT a candidate for SoftWave therapy?

    SoftWave therapy is not suitable for individuals who are pregnant, have a pacemaker, or have cancer. At your first appointment, the provider can further discuss any conditions that would impact your ability to receive therapy.

  • Does SoftWave therapy have side effects?

    Side effects from SoftWave therapy are minimal and non-restrictive. SoftWave does not cause bruising or swelling, although some patients may experience slight redness and soreness that typically subsides within one to two days. While recovery downtime is not usually needed, we recommend avoiding high-impact movements or exercise for the first 24-48 hours.

  • What conditions and injuries are treated by SoftWave therapy?

    SoftWave therapy treats an array of conditions, injuries and symptoms, including:

    • Joint and muscle pain like knee, shoulder, and lower back pain
    • Overuse injuries like plantar fasciitis, achilles tendinitis, and jumpers knee
    • Orthopedic conditions like carpal tunnel, meniscus tears, and soft tissue injuries
    • Ulcers, wounds, burns
    • Neuropathies
    • Post-surgical healing

    This list grows each year as new applications are discovered for this breakthrough technology.
